How many square feet does a wall heater heat?
Electric wall heaters require a dedicated circuit, and run on either 120 or 240 volts, with several wattage options. How large of an area your heater will cover depends on the wattage. Generally, 1,000 watts = 100 square feet of heat.

How much does it cost to install wall heater?
The national average to install an electric wall heater costs approximately $782. On the low end, you could pay as little as $400 or as much as $1,800 or more on the higher end. The heater itself can be inexpensive and range from $60 to $120 for the unit.

How much does it cost to run a gas wall heater?
Did you know one gallon of Propane costs approximately $3.00 (local average)? One gallon of Propane contains 92,000 Btu's, which will operate a 30,000 Btu wall heater for a little more than 3 hours. This means the cost to operate a 30,000 Btu wall heater using Propane is around $. 80 per hour.

Installation rates for electric wall heaters vary depending on the type of heater selected and how much prep work is needed. Labor costs range from $85-$200. If your project requires extensive electrical work the cost may increase by $400 or more. The heater itself can cost between $100-$500.
Electric Wall Heater Installation
Wall mounted electric heaters offer a cost-effective way to warm areas of your home that need occasional supplemental heat or aren’t served well by your central heating system. Installing these heaters requires very little preparation, and they do not require special ventilation or access to fuel lines.

How Long It Will Take to Install a Water Heater?
Barring unforeseen events or complications, a professional plumber can install a water heater within two to three hours. Installing it yourself can take a longer time, mainly if you have limited plumbing and electrical or gas system knowledge.
Why does it take so long to install a water heater?
Installing a water heater in a cramped space may take a longer time because of the preparations required. You may have to remove obstacles, reroute your water pipes, and make provisions for fuel source access.
